I wouldnt bother, I know you do have it, and if you like testing stuff whether its good or bad , then go ahead. I think its going to slow you down.

You have your combo running pretty good as it is. I like to test things that I think will make it faster.

With your Dynamic 4000 or so vert ????, that 272 duration will hurt your 60 ft. and it probably wont recover at the stripe, even though it could MPH a little better.

If your into testing , have at it.

You did leave out some important variables, like compression, tire diameter, cars weight, actual vert stall,and header primary tube diameter.

Those are all important Combo factors as well, along with the other known info you posted. So I or anybodys info is just a assumption at this point. Even with all the combos info, they will be , just Better assumptions.

I ran one for a few years on my iron head +.060. 440 six pac pistons 0 deck heads were hand ported pretty good 2.14/1.81 and milled about .070 for about 11.5 to 1 team G intake 2" hooker headers 4.1 gears 800 holly SMR 727 with 4000 SMR converter.
Adjustable pushrods for setting preload to .020. (stock rockers)

Car was about 4000 or more with me in at at the time consistant 12.0's and in good air a best of 11.84.

had the cam in at 106 later put in friends car much the same little less compression at 102 it really liked that.


Think it would benefit from 1.6 rokers
